Chapter 915 General Development Requirements <br /> <br /> Page 915-11 <br />c. Any such vehicle shall not be parked or stored within 5 feet of a side or rear <br />lot line. Vehicles may be parked within the required front setback provided <br />vehicles are parked on an approved asphalt, concrete or pavers and shall not be <br />within 10 feet of the front yard property line. <br />d. Such vehicles shall not be parked between the living space of the house and <br />the street. <br />e. Recreational vehicles shall not be used as living or sleeping quarters for more <br />than 14 days per year. <br /> <br /> <br />D.
